How many tetrahedron-shaped retroreflective trim pieces are around the crown, and what are they made of?

Explanation:
Retroreflective trim around the crown is designed to maximize visibility by returning light to its source from all directions. There are eight tetrahedron-shaped pieces around the crown, and they’re made of 3M Scotchlite retroreflective material. This combination ensures bright, durable reflectivity when illuminated by lights (like helmet beams or vehicle headlights), improving recognition in low-light or smoky conditions. The eight-piece arrangement provides even coverage around the head, which a smaller number would miss, and 3M Scotchlite is preferred over older options like glass bead or vinyl trim for modern PPE because of its durability and strong, consistent reflectivity.
